With its cosy log burner, stone walls, and private courtyard, this cottage is perfect for a peaceful countryside retreat. Inside, it’s snug and homely – a great base to return to after long days outdoors. The kitchenette is compact, ideal for breakfasts and light meals, leaving plenty of excuse for pub lunches and afternoon teas. Outside, the hot tub is a tranquil spot to unwind under the stars. There’s not much in the way of nearby attractions, but if scenic walks, coastal exploring, and a good dose of peace and quiet are what you’re after, this is exactly the place to relax.

Home truths

    There's no full kitchen here, though there is a small nook with a microwave, hob, and sink. We think it's better suited to prepping lighter bites than large meals.

    The bedroom is on a mezzanine level reached by steps – it may not be the best option for those with limited mobility.

    Due to this home's location, we recommend hiring a car to get the most out of your stay. There's free parking here.

    Well-behaved pets may be welcome upon request

About The Pembrokeshire Coast

Fabulous coastal scenery? Tick. Big, sandy beaches? Tick. More outdoor activities than you can shake a carabiner at? Absolutely. If you’re any kind of outdoorsy person, this place has you covered. With footpaths, cycleways, beaches and waves, the Pembrokeshire coast is for surfing and sandcastle-building, and everything in between.
